Backplane installation rules and order

This section contains information on the backplane installation rules and order.

2.5-inch drive backplane

Note
  • When one or more of the following components are installed in the system, the maximum number of supported backplanes is two (sixteen 2.5-inch drives).
    • ThinkSystem Mellanox ConnectX-6 Dx 100GbE QSFP56 2-port PCIe Ethernet Adapter
    • ThinkSystem Nvidia ConnectX-7 NDR200/HDR QSFP112 2-Port PCIe Gen5 x16 InfiniBand Adapter
    • ThinkSystem Nvidia ConnectX-7 NDR400 OSFP 1-Port PCIe Gen5 Adapter
    • ThinkSystem 96GB TruDDR5 6400MHz (2Rx4) 10x4 RDIMM
    • ThinkSystem 128GB TruDDR5 6400MHz (2Rx4) RDIMM
  • When ThinkSystem 256GB TruDDR5 6400MHz (4Rx4) 3DS RDIMM is installed in the system, the maximum number of supported backplanes is one (eight 2.5-inch drives).
  • AnyBay backplanes currently support NVMe drives only. Support for SAS/SATA drives or NVMe + SAS/SATA drives will be enabled via a firmware update in Q4 of 2025.
The server supports up to three 2.5-inch drive backplanes with the following corresponding drive backplane numbers.

Note
  • 2.5-inch SAS/SATA drive backplanes support 2.5-inch SAS/SATA drives.

  • 2.5-inch AnyBay drive backplanes support 2.5-inch NVMe drives.

E3.S backplanes

The server supports up to eight E3.S backplanes with the following corresponding backplane numbers.

Note
  • E3.S 1T bays support E3.S 1T drives
  • E3.S 2T bays support E3.S 2T CMMs
